/*
* Style by Rogie http://www.komodomedia.com/blog/2007/01/css-star-rating-redux/
*/

.post-rating-wrapper {
  background: #f8f8f8; /* Old browsers */
  background: -moz-linear-gradient(top, #f8f8f8 0%, #f0f0f0 100%); /* FF3.6+ */
  background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#f8f8f8), color-stop(100%,#f0f0f0)); /* Chrome,Safari4+ */
  background: -webkit-linear-gradient(top, #f8f8f8 0%,#f0f0f0 100%); /* Chrome10+,Safari5.1+ */
  background: -o-linear-gradient(top, #f8f8f8 0%,#f0f0f0 100%); /* Opera 11.10+ */
  background: -ms-linear-gradient(top, #f8f8f8 0%,#f0f0f0 100%); /* IE10+ */
  background: linear-gradient(to bottom, #f8f8f8 0%,#f0f0f0 100%); /* W3C */
  fil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#f8f8f8', endColorstr='#f0f0f0',GradientType=0 ); /* IE6-9 */
  width: 200px;	
  border: 1px solid #E2E2E2;
  border-radius: 15px;
  height: 24px;
  padding-left: 6px;
  box-shadow: 0px 1px 1px #B1B1B1;
}

.small-ajaxful-rating-wrapper {
	width: 60px;
	float: left;
}

.ajaxful-rating-wrapper {
	width: 125px;
	float: left;
}

.rate-it {
	width: 50px;
	float: left;
	line-height: 25px;
/*  color: #438EC8;*/
	margin-left: 5px;
	margin-bottom: 5px;
  background: url(/images/ajaxful_rating/separator.png) no-repeat left;
  padding-left: 14px;
}

.ajaxful-rating,
.ajaxful-rating a:hover,
.ajaxful-rating a:active,
.ajaxful-rating a:focus,
.ajaxful-rating .current-rating{
    background: url(/images/ajaxful_rating/star-new.png) left -1000px repeat-x;
}
.ajaxful-rating{
    position: relative;
    /*width: 125px; this is setted dynamically */
    height: 25px;
    overflow: hidden;
    list-style: none;
    margin: 0;
    padding: 0;
    background-position: left top;
}
.ajaxful-rating li{ display: inline; }
.ajaxful-rating a,
.ajaxful-rating span,
.ajaxful-rating .current-rating{
    position: absolute;
    top: 0;
    left: 0;
    text-indent: -1000em;
    height: 25px;
    line-height: 25px;
    outline: none;
    overflow: hidden;
    border: none;
}
.ajaxful-rating a:hover,
.ajaxful-rating a:active,
.ajaxful-rating a:focus{
    /* need to be important to beat the theme editor */
    background-color: transparent !important;
    background-position: left bottom;
}

/* This section is generated dynamically.
Just add a call to the helper method 'ajaxful_rating_style' within
the head tags in your main layout 
.ajaxful-rating .stars-1{
width: 20%;
z-index: 6;
}
.ajaxful-rating .stars-2{
width: 40%;
z-index: 5;
}
.ajaxful-rating .stars-3{
width: 60%;
z-index: 4;
}
.ajaxful-rating .stars-4{
width: 80%;
z-index: 3;
}
.ajaxful-rating .stars-5{
width: 100%;
z-index: 2;
}
*/
.ajaxful-rating .current-rating{
    background-position: left center;
}

/* smaller star */
.small-star{
    /*width: 50px; this is setted dynamically */
    height: 10px;
}
.small-star,
.small-star a:hover,
.small-star a:active,
.small-star a:focus,
.small-star .current-rating{
    background-image: url(/images/ajaxful_rating/star_small.png);
    line-height: 10px;
    height: 10px;
}
